Thunderbird 2

Waterjets for 22 knots and a 1000m-capable Triton submarine called, what else, Thunderbird 4!
Fans of UK TV producer Gerry Anderson will understand immediately what this vessel is all about. If not, a little explanation may be appropriate…
Designed to carry three PAX, a 1000m capable Triton submarine (Thunderbird 4, of course!), Thunderbird 2 features an 8.5t capacity hydraulic platform for launch and recovery of the sub and other toys, along with the array of battery chargers and oxygen storage and transfer systems required to fully support the submarine.
Overall dimensions are 22m x 10m and, being based in the Caribbean, her full load draft of less than 1.1m, allowing access to places unimaginable in a conventional yacht.
She was built by Brilliant Boats using lightweight aluminium construction to DNV HSLC, and an interior in balsa, honeycomb and Forex, means she weighs in at just over 54 tons lightship, and has a full load displacement of only 72 tons, including seven tons of fuel and eight tons of Triton 3300/3.
The interior, styled by Miami interior designer Karine Rousseau, offers spacious accommodation in two lower deck suites, one for the owner and one for guests, and huge entertaining spaces, and a head, office and large galley on the main deck. 
A flexibly mounted and heavily insulated interior means that even at full speed, sound levels are a super quiet 65dB in the lower deck accommodation and 72db on the main deck.
The aft deck is the centre of operations for the submarine, with a dedicated sub support locker, but also has dive bottle storage and filling, a fuel pump and davits for the tender and large swim steps with bathing ladder for easy access to the water. 
Forward is an al fresco dining area, a giant sun pad for relaxing, and barbeque and bar area with built-in fridge and icemaker.
Twin Yanmar 8SY engines (900hp ea) and Hamilton 521 waterjets provide performance of 22 knots at full speed and a transatlantic range at an economic cruise speed of 10 knots.
Although built for a private client, Thunderbird 2 complies fully with MGN 280, allowing him the opportunity commercialise this unique package.
A sistership is already under construction at BB Yacht and is available for delivery in time for next summer.
Specifications:
LOA: 21.5m
LWL:19.6m
Draft (Full Load): 1.1m
Displacement Full Load (Light): 72t (54t)
Fuel Capacity: 7200 litres
Fresh Water Capacity: 1200 litres
Watermaker: 2400 litres/day
Maximum Platform Payload: 8.5t
Propulsion: 2 x Yanmar 8SY (900hp), ZF 360, Hamilton HM 521 Waterjets
Generators: Kohler 30kW, 20kW night set (110/208v 60Hz, 3P)
Naval Architect: Brilliant Boats
Exterior Design: Brilliant Boats
Interior Design: Karine Rousseau
Builder: BB Yacht, Antalya Free Zone, Turkey
Classification: DNV A1 HSLC R0 Yacht, MGN 280
